[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: 问个如何远程使用X的问题



-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Jian Jun Wang wrote:
> 可能标题描述的不太对。
>
> 我是想这样:
>
> 我的一台电脑上安装了debian,里面有个用户叫jerry,每次开机到KDE下,可 以输入密码进 入。我想在另外一台电脑windows
> 上远程连接到自己的电脑上。也想用X界面。 请问如何才能 行?
>
> 我现在可以用putty ssh上去,当然也是用的jerry用户,只是如果可以在 windows上连接上 去的话,那就是我的debian
> 有个jerry在用,我远程这个帐号也在用,不知道 这样可以不?
>
> 可以的话如何实现呢?
>
> 可能有点简单,给个link也可以。
>
> 多谢。
>
> -- TNT - Today, Not Tomorrow

    首先,Debian不是XP,他不管你是多用户登录还是一个用户多登录。不过如
果同一个用户多次登录的话,那么在打开同一个程序的时候,可能~/.*这种文件
会有读写冲突或者锁定/版本同步的问题。建议用两个用户,或者尽量不使用同
一个程序。
    然后,你把远程的6010端口(或者看哪个空)用ssh隧道导到本地来,具体要
看sshd的配置和你用的客户端。可以查看/etc/ssh/sshd_config来得到sshd的配
置状况。本地的你自己查吧,我用的是F-SecureSSH。这个步骤是X forward,使
得你远程的X连接可以安全的到达本地。(当然――理论上说,只要你不怕,这步也
用不着做)
    最后需要在你机器上安装一个Xserver,我用的是Xming。开启并且监听0端
口(注意这个要和SSH中forward的设置一致)。用ssh登录远程机器,然后
$export DISPLAY=localhost:10(此处对应SSH隧道的远程端口设置)
$/etc/X11/Xsession &
    这样就可以远程使用X了。
    如果需要使用声音,用esound4win,然后同样设置就好了。

- --
与其相濡以沫,不如相忘于江湖
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.5 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org

iD8DBQFFTsRkOhzb4WnHl2oRAtCOAKCKFN6NS8q/HD6I2EtCqvBILCN2ngCgqF2i
uspdO2EfIGRfFchowbEXsp0=
=J1qB
-----END PGP SIGNATURE-----


Reply to: